Description

This breath-taking home with superb grounds is your dream escape to the country. Elizabeth Humphreys Homes are delighted to welcome to the market this stunning 3 bedroomed detached bungalow located in the Northumberland village of Swarland. Beautifully secluded and with gorgeous wrap-around gardens, this family home is incredibly well-presented and has been finished to an extraordinarily high standard incorporating impressive and quality fixtures and fittings throughout. The property features driveway parking leading up to a double garage with an electric up and over door, uPVC windows and composite doors, high quality light wood Amtico LVT flooring, brushed steel sockets and switches throughout, superior internal oak doors, LPG central heating, super-fast fibre connection for those who work from home, and all the other usual mains connections. This incredibly attractive, sociable and comfortable family home is situated in a prestigious area making it one of the most sought-after properties in the locality.

Swarland is an idyllic village which boasts its own Primary School, ‘Nelsons’ coffee shop, children’s play area, tennis courts, a village golf course and club house, equestrian facilities, a village hall and stunning views of the coast and countryside and walks into the countryside minutes from your front door. A two minute drive from the A1, this village is perfectly located for easy access north into Scotland and south to Newcastle and beyond.

This home has been designed to take full advantage of the stunning wrap-around gardens, creating opportunities within every room to allow you to view and appreciate the soothing and relaxing views. A couple of steps lead up to a striking composite front door which opens into an internal porch furnished with coir carpet. This welcoming space leaves you in no doubt to the quality of living offered by this superbly modernised property from this point onwards. A pair of oak and glass doors open into the L-shaped main hallway and allow a wealth of natural light to circulate. The hallway provides convenient access to the main living spaces and a further pair of oak and glass doors lead to the lounge-kitchen-diner.

Beautifully light and bright and exuding modernity, the kitchen offers plenty of wall and base units in a pale grey matt door complemented by a Silestone worksurface with a matching upstand and brushed chrome switches and sockets. An impressive centre island incorporates a large five-burner NEFF induction hob with a designer-looking light fitting suspended above in addition of a breakfast bar area. In terms of fitted equipment, there is a bank of larder units one of which houses an eye-level combination microwave and separate oven, both of which are NEFF appliances, a fully integrated full height fridge-freezer, drawer packs, a full-sized fully integrated NEFF dishwasher, and a bowl and a half square inset Blanco SS stainless-steel sink with a Hansgrohe tap above. The view of the garden from this point is glorious and can be appreciated whilst carrying out daily tasks or creating culinary delights.

A couple of steps down takes you to a useful utility space which houses the Vaillant combi LPG gas boiler for ease of access. The same quality fittings and work surface to those of the kitchen continues here, and there is a further bowl and a half stainless steel sink with a designer-looking tap and plumbing and space for a washing machine and space for a tumble dryer. A door provides external access to the side of the property where the LPG gas tank is located. Furthermore a door opens to the garage with amenities such as power and lighting.

The quality of finish continues as you move through from the kitchen to the living-dining space. The lighting structures impress immediately: the fireplace, with quartz tiling to either side, is illuminated perfectly by the modern up lighters and the central light above the dining table is a uniquely designed bespoke fitting; simply breathtaking. An AGA multi fuel stove with a quartz tile surround is nestled within the chimneybreast, enticing you to sit before it during the cooler months. Further windows provide glimpses of the garden, whilst a set of French doors with windows to either side open onto a gorgeous, terraced area which captures a Spanish ambience: an ideal place to relax and unwind at the end of the day.

The bedrooms, showcasing Farrow and Ball type neutral hues, are beautifully well-presented allowing the easy addition of accent colour should you so wish. The sumptuous carpets ensure maximum comfort as you move between the different spaces and a sense of rest and peace surrounds you.

The primary bedroom is a spacious double with French doors opening into the garden in addition to a large window offering further garden views, adding to the appeal of this property. A dimmer switch ensures that optimum lighting can be achieved at any time of day and this space oozes peace and tranquillity

Bedroom 2 is another good-sized double with a large window allowing a wealth of natural light. This room features an ensuite which comprises a double sized shower cubicle with a Merlin sliding door with a Hansgrohe waterfall shower head and a separate shower head within, a wall-hung mahogany-look vanity unit with a Duravit white sink on top, an electric mirror and a white close-coupled toilet with a push button. A tall white heated towel rail ensures added comfort and the designer Porcelanosa tiling, illuminated by ceiling spotlights and natural light, completes the look of this boutique hotel-style bathroom.

Bedroom 3 is a large single which would incorporate a double if you so wished. Again capturing stunning garden views, this is another calm and peaceful room.

Featuring glorious embossed white tiling behind a free-standing contemporary double-ended white bath with a Hansgrohe free standing tap with shower attachment, the family bathroom exudes comfort and relaxation. A wood-look vanity unit houses a large Duravit winged sink and Duravit concealed-cistern toilet with a push button and white heated towel rail ensures added comfort. A window to the side allows for natural light.

The wrap-around garden, views of which can be enjoyed from all rooms, is an oasis of calm which cleverly combines a landscaped country-cottage garden with a hint of Spanish vibe. The mature trees and shrubs form a green and leafy backdrop to the good sized lawned area framed by a path around the perimeter of the house. The porcelain patio forming a stunning terraced area which can be accessed from the dining room captures the Spanish feel perfectly and invites you to experience alfresco dining with family and friends during those warm summer months.
